Basement water cleanup services involve the removal of excess water from a basement area caused by flooding, leaks, or plumbing failures. These services typically include water extraction, drying, and dehumidification to prevent further damage. Technicians may also assess the extent of water intrusion and identify sources of moisture to ensure thorough cleanup. Proper water removal is essential to prevent mold growth, structural deterioration, and secondary damage that can compromise the integrity of the property.

The overview below groups typical Basement Water Cleanup proj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mesa, AZ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Assessment and Inspection Costs - The initial evaluation for basement water cleanup typically ranges from $200 to $500, depending on the extent of the damage. This fee covers identifying sources of water intrusion and assessing affected areas.
Water Extraction Expenses - Removing standing water from a basement can cost between $1,000 and $3,000. The price varies based on the water volume and the complexity of the extraction process.
Mold Remediation Costs - If mold is present after water damage, remediation services may range from $500 to $6,000. Costs depend on the mold's size and the affected materials needing treatment or removal.
Cleanup and Restoration Fees - Complete basement cleanup, including drying, disinfecting, and restoring, generally falls between $2,000 and $8,000. The final cost depends on the extent of damage and necessary repairs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the common causes of basement water issues? Basement water problems can result from heavy rainfall, plumbing leaks, poor drainage, or foundation cracks. Consulting local service providers can help identify the specific cause in each case.
How do professionals typically remove water from a flooded basement? Local water cleanup specialists often use pumps, wet vacuums, and dehumidifiers to extract water and dry the area effectively.
Is mold prevention part of basement water cleanup? Many service providers include mold prevention and remediation as part of their water damage restoration process to prevent health issues and property damage.
